A new triathlon event has been announced in Eastern Iowa. The first annual Peregrine Charities Triathlon will originate from the popular George Wyth State Park, located just off Highway 218 between Waterloo and Cedar Falls, Iowa.
Triathlon: Peregrine Charities Triathlon
When: Sunday, September 28, 2008 @ 7:30 AM
Where: George Wyth State Park, Waterloo, IA, USA
Divisions: Elite, Age Group, Relays
Website: www.peregrinecharities.org/tri
The triathlon event will feature a 1 mile Swim in George Wyth Lake, a 22 mile Bike ride on scenic rural roads and a 6 mile Run on paved trails through scenic George Wyth State Park and Hartman Reserve Nature Center. The triathlon event is open to Individuals and Relay Teams. Cash prizes will be awarded to the top three overall female and male elite finishers and to the first place finishers in each of the female and male age groups, Clydesdale, Athena and Relay Team divisions.
Proceeds from registrations to the first-annual Peregrine Charities Triathlon will directly benefit Peregrine Charities.
Registration for this new triathlon event is currently open. Registration is $65.00 for USAT members and $75.00 for non-members. You can register online via active.com or print and mail in your registration form via US mail.

About Peregrine Charities
Peregrine Charities grants funds to Eastern Iowa hospitals to assist with their care of children and to fund ground-breaking research investigating origins, treatments, and cures for rare childhood diseases. The ultimate goal is to provide children with comfort, dignity, and hope during difficult times.
